Phil Esposito revolutionized offensive hockey with the Boston Bruins, becoming the first player to score 100 points in a season and later breaking the single-season goal record with 76 in 1970-71. The Hall of Famer won two Stanley Cups with the Bruins and five Art Ross Trophies.
